On 15th August 2025 New Acropolis Pune branch hosted a talk “True Freedom – Lessons from Swami Vivekananda” . The talk explored the deeper meaning of freedom through the lens of an Indian Hindu monk, philosopher, author, religious teacher Swami Vivekananda.
The session began by challenging the common understanding of freedom as merely the absence of external constraints.
“The speaker emphasized that true freedom lies in our ability to respond consciously, rather than react instinctively, to life’s circumstances.
Drawing from Vivekananda’s seminal work Jnana Yoga, the talk highlighted that freedom from Maya (illusion)—our thoughts, emotions, and instincts—is the essence of inner liberation. Participants were encouraged to learn to seek self-knowledge and distinguish between their true self and the illusions that cloud it.
A powerful quote shared during the session was:
“Each soul is potentially divine. The goal is to manifest this Divinity within by controlling nature, external and internal…”
